The trend of Ionisation in a periodic table

The ionisation process altogether can form the ionic radius and atomic radii, electron, metallicity, etc.

  1. Ionisation energy, for the most part, increases moving from left to right across a component period (column). 
  • It is mainly because the nuclear sweep, for the most part, diminishes on getting across a period. 
  • There is a more prominent successful fascination between the charged electrons and emphatically charged electrons.
  • Ionisation is at its base incentive for the antacid metal on the left half of the table and the greatest for the honourable gas on the extreme right half of a period. 
  • The honourable gas has a filled valence shell, so it opposes electron evacuation.
  1. Ionisation diminishes, dropping through and through down a component bunch.
  • There are more protons in particles dropping down a gathering (more noteworthy positive charge), yet the impact is to pull in the electron shells, making them more modest and screening external electrons from the appealing power of the core. 
  • More electron shells are added, dropping down a gathering, so the furthest electron turns out to be progressively distant from the core.
